HWM), headquartered in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ania, is a leading global provider of advanced engineered solutions for the aerospace and transportation industries. Our primary businesses focus on jet engine components, aerospace fastening systems, titanium structural parts and forged wheels. With $8.3 Billion in revenue in 2025, our products play a crucial role in enabling fuel efficiency and lightweighting, contributing to our customers' success and making a positive impact on the world. What You Bring Required:
High school diploma or
GED Preferred:
Associate's degree in Electronics or a related technical field
Experience or training with CNC machine controls and PLCs
Experience working with 480/277/220V three-phase power, transformers, and electrical wiring
Electrical/electronic troubleshooting experience in a manufacturing environment
Ability to read and interpret electrical schematics, drawings, specifications, and technical documentation
Strong troubleshooting and problem-solving skills
Ability to prioritize multiple tasks and determine the appropriate sequence of work
Computer experience with maintenance-related databases or systems
Background in electrical engineering or related technical disciplines Employment Requirements Employees must be legally authorized to work in the United States.
